#5cd266 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5cd266 is composed of 36.1% red, 82.4%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 125.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 59.2%. #5cd266 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ffcc with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#5cd266 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5cd266 has RGB values of R:92, G:210,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 6083174.

Shades and Tints of #5cd266

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020602 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5cd266

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949a95 is the less saturated color, while #34fa45 is the most saturated one.
